Output 099a2659cd5bd93de152f945dcd33cfa2b4fc03fd498186d66c344a5929e2e26:20

value
145757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04e8c89854ca1de514e0d46ff6b34414c6b74840 OP_EQUAL
address
328yVQ12GDyWVjt6mbR3g32HHDM8ra9zin
transaction
099a2659cd5bd93de152f945dcd33cfa2b4fc03fd498186d66c344a5929e2e26
confirmations
121678
spent
true